Conveniently located across the Pearl River from the state capitol of Jackson and part of Rankin County, the City of Richland is a small town with a big heart. Richland recently became a National Weather Service Storm Ready community, proving that it takes the safety of its people and property seriously. The people who live and conduct business on Richland property are very happy to be here. Its strategic location near major thoroughfares and transportation corridors have made Richland the hub of a thriving transportation, warehousing and distribution industry.
Education in Richland
Students living in Richland real estate attend public schools overseen by the award-winning Rankin County School District. The public schools located within Richland city limits are: Richland Elementary (grades K-2), Richland Upper Elementary (grades 3-6) and Richland High School (grades 7-12). In addition, a private preschool (Kids Konnection) is available for parents who want to give their children a jump start on their educational careers.
